Automated Guided Vehicles or Autonomous Mobile Robots are increasingly used in automated transport. AGVs follow a fixed line and cannot deviate from it, unlike AMRs that can avoid objects.
ATB Automation supplies compact wheel drives consisting of a DC controller with a BLDC servo motor and a gearbox.
Leadshine BLDC servo controller and motor
The dc drives are suitable for connection to batteries with a supply voltage of 24 or 48Vdc. The controllers can be controlled via CANOpen, Modbus (RS485), pulse direction or analog.
The brushless DC servo motors are maintenance-free and very compact. Available in 200W to 2000W.
Leadshine BLDC servo motors with integrated drive
In addition to the version with a separate controller, the motors are also available with a controller mounted directly on the motor. This saves wiring.
Available are motors with 200W, 400W and 750W.

Wanshsin planetary gearboxes
The motors can be supplied with mounted compact planetary gearboxes in reductions from 3:1 to 200:1 in straight and right-angle versions.
Versions are available with straight teeth and helical teeth for a lower noise level.
Depending on the mounting of the wheel, a gear unit with output shaft or output flange can be selected.
BLDC servo motor with right-angle planetary gearbox with the wheel mounted on the output shaft

KGV wheel drives
The KGV wheel drive consists of a planetary gearbox with reductions from 2:1 to 40:1 and a special bearing housing on which a wheel is mounted. This creates a very compact and robust drive.
The wheel is made of wear-resistant polyurethane (PU).
The KGV series is available in 4 sizes with wheel diameters of at least 150, 160, 180 or 250 mm.
The Leadshine bldc servo motor mounts directly into the gearbox.
